A Practical Guide to Shabbos Email
This year-long class series covers the 39 Melachos of Shabbos in detail with a focus on the practical issues that arise in the kitchen, around the house, and in shul.

Chazal made a general gezeira regarding medical treatment on shabbos based on the prohibition on grinding. This shiur discusses why and goes into the details of medications and medical treatment on shabbos.

Winnowing, selecting, and sifting together constitute "borrer", one of the most detailed and challenging malachot to understand and master. The distance between a permitted act and a Torah prohibition, says the Mishna Brura, is but a hair's breadth in width.
